Thumbs up Greencine online dvd rental service *review*

I've been using this new online dvd rental service from San Fran for about a month now and I'm happy to report back the good results:

huge selection of rare and hard to find movies (anime, independent, foreign, mature, etc) they still have the typical blockbuster flicks too.

super fast turnaround - i got 3 movies in, ripped them, mailed them back the same night... they would receive them the next day and ship out 3 new movies. i would get them the following day.

cardboard mailers - i have yet to receive a cracked or scratched dvd. none of the other dvd rental places used cardboard

pricing - is about the same as netflix/walmart/blockbuster

*******************
before this i used the following:

blockbuster - 2 months
long delivery, 2-3 day minimum turnaround
so-so selection
one plus is they give you 2 free in-store coupons for those moments when you want to watch something on the spur of the moment

walmart - 2 months
about the same as blockbuster but cheaper by $2-3
they're the devil !

netflix - 3 months
1st month was fast turnaround
huge selection
2nd month, they slowed down delivery ON PURPOSE (it's been documented on other sites too)
lots of scratched dvds
